No extremal square-free words over large alphabets [PDF]
A word is square-free if it does not contain any square (a word of the form \(XX\)), and is extremal square-free if it cannot be extended to a new square-free word by inserting a single letter at any position.

Pattern Avoidance in Reverse Double Lists [PDF]
In this paper, we consider pattern avoidance in a subset of words on $\{1,1,2,2,\dots,n,n\}$ called reverse double lists. In particular a reverse double list is a word formed by concatenating a permutation with its reversal.

Chain enumeration, partition lattices and polynomials with only real roots [PDF]
The coefficients of the chain polynomial of a finite poset enumerate chains in the poset by their number of elements. The chain polynomials of the partition lattices and their standard type \(B\) analogues are shown to have only real roots.
